Located in the heart of the Wessex Downs, a landscape packed with gorgeous views, wonderful wildlife, and intriguing history, the historic market town of Marlborough boasts a beautiful high street with an extensive range of shopping facilities, a weekly market, a public library, and a variety of restaurants and pubs. Discover A hidden gem for exploring and world-class hiking, this area is characterised by remote, rolling downland and picture-postcard villages, old woods, and sparkling rivers and streams. Nearby Savernake Forest, an old Forest bordered by trails and paths, is part of the environment that surrounds the town that has been designated as an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ty.
The forest is home to the largest beech avenue in Britain and features lush, flat green pitches surrounded by registered oak, beech, and sweet chestnut trees.
